English

holds a special place at our Academy, offering pupils a gateway to the wider world through literature, language, and critical thinking. We believe that a love of reading and strong communication skills are essential for academic success and personal growth. Our unique location in the heart of London provides a rich literary backdrop to bring the English curriculum to life -- with iconic writers such as Dickens and Shakespeare having set their stories just on our doorstep. As a Teacher of English, you will plan and deliver engaging lessons across Key Stages 3 to 5, support students of all abilities, and contribute to a vibrant curriculum that explores a diverse range of texts and genres. You'll also play an active role in enrichment activities and the wider life of the school. For experienced candidates, additional responsibilities may be available.

Borough Academy is a co-educational 11-18 school located in Borough, London on the former site of Southwark Fire Station.



Borough Academy is a part of the Haberdashers' Academies Trust South, which is a strong network of nine schools in south London and north Kent.
